Understanding 'Wahl Ergebnisse': What the Term Truly Means

To accurately search for and understand the information you're looking for, it's crucial to break down the German phrase "bayern wahl ergebnisse."

  • Bayern: In this context, it refers not to the football club, but to Bavaria, Germany's largest state by land area and second-most populous. Bavaria is a politically significant region, often playing a crucial role in national German politics due to its economic strength and cultural distinctiveness.
  • Wahl: This translates directly to "election." In Germany, elections are held at various levels: federal (Bundestagswahl), state (Landtagswahl), and municipal (Kommunalwahl).
  • Ergebnisse: This simply means "results."

Therefore, when combined, "bayern wahl ergebnisse" specifically denotes the "Bavarian election results." These results detail which political parties have gained seats in the Bavarian state parliament (Landtag), who has won direct mandates, and the overall distribution of votes across the state. This is a complex political process, far removed from the simple win/loss outcome of a football match. The nuances involve voter turnout, percentage of votes for each party, and the formation of potential coalition governments—information that requires dedicated political reporting.

Navigating to the Right Sources for 'Bayern Wahl Ergebnisse'

So, if sports sites are off-limits, where should you actually turn to find accurate and up-to-date information on Bavarian election results? The good news is that there are many highly reliable sources. Your search strategy needs to shift from a sports-centric approach to a politically and geographically focused one.

Recommended Sources for Bavarian Election Results:

  1. Official Bavarian State Websites: The Bavarian State Parliament (Bayerischer Landtag) or the Bavarian State Office for Statistics (Bayerisches Landesamt für Statistik) are primary, authoritative sources. These sites will host historical data, current election results, and detailed breakdowns by constituency.
  2. Major German News Outlets: Reputable German newspapers and broadcasters offer extensive political coverage. Look for sites like:
    • Süddeutsche Zeitung (SZ): Based in Munich, it offers excellent local and state-level political analysis.
    • Frankfurter Allgemeine Zeitung (FAZ): A leading national newspaper known for its in-depth political reporting.
    • Der Spiegel / Die Zeit: Prominent German magazines with strong online presences for political news.
    • Tagesschau / ZDFheute: The online platforms of Germany's public broadcasters, known for their impartial and comprehensive news coverage.
    These outlets will provide not just the raw numbers but also expert analysis, commentary on coalition possibilities, and the implications of the results for both Bavaria and Germany.
  3. International News Organizations with German Desks: Major international news agencies like Reuters, Associated Press, BBC News, or Deutsche Welle often have dedicated sections covering German politics, especially during significant state elections.

Practical Tips for Refining Your Search:

To avoid future misdirection and streamline your information retrieval process, consider these actionable tips:

  • Be Specific with Keywords: Instead of just "bayern wahl ergebnisse," try "Landtagswahl Bayern" (Bavarian state election), "Bayerische Landtagswahl Ergebnisse" (Bavarian state election results), or include the specific year, e.g., "Landtagswahl Bayern 2023 Ergebnisse."
  • Specify the Language: If you're using an international search engine, consider adding "Germany" or "German elections" to clarify the geographical context.
  • Check the URL: Before clicking on a link, quickly glance at the URL. Does it belong to a news organization, a government domain (.gov or specific country TLD like .de), or a statistical office? This can often tell you immediately if the source is relevant.
  • Utilize German Search Engines: Searching directly on Google.de or other German-specific search engines can sometimes yield more localized and relevant results.
